...WIND CHILL 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 6 AM EST TUESDAY...

* WHAT...Very cold wind chills. Wind chills as low as 20 below
  zero.

* WHERE...Carbon and Monroe counties.

* WHEN...Until 6 AM EST Tuesday.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...The very cold wind chills could cause
  frostbite on exposed skin in as little as 30 minutes.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Wind Chill Advisory means that cold air and the wind will
combine to create low wind chills. Frostbite and hypothermia can
occur if precautions are not taken. Make sure you wear a hat and
gloves.
